When MKCE was first established in April 2008 we saw the opportunity to push the social enterprise agenda and raise the profile of social enterprise. Since then we have campaigned for social enterprise to be represented at strategic meetings and disseminated information from regional and national bodies to social enterprises in Milton Keynes. The network has operated informally, with newsletters; meetings; special interest seminars and surveys for some time.
However in the changing climate we are being asked to ‘represent’ social enterprise and we believe that we need a mandate to do this. So we have formalised our ‘membership’. We will still circulate our e-bulletin but it will become more proactive in seeking feedback from readers.

What we have achieved as a Network in 2010/11
- Survey and Focus Group on Barriers to Growth for MK Council Economic Assessment - click to view survey results
- 2 Social Enterprise Visits – we funded an Open House at the CARC and Buszy visit
- Representation of social enterprise on MKCLIP
- Representation of social enterprise in MK on the se2 regional partnership
- Representation of social enterprise in MK on SEMLEP (South East Midlands Social Enterprise Partnership)
- Meeting with BIS and DCLG
- Input into the Future of Business Support – consultation by Durham University for BIS
- Meeting in MK on Business Support – organised by MK Council.
